Payroll/HRIS Administrator



Roundabout Theatre Company, one of the nation’s largest not-for-profit theatres, seeks an energetic, personable individual to join the company’s Finance Department as Payroll/HRIS Administrator. The position reports to the Payroll Manager and works closely with the Director of Human Resources.



The Payroll/HRIS Administrator will have ongoing daily, weekly and monthly responsibility for:



Payroll:

• Process weekly and bi-weekly non-union payroll through ADP Workforce Now

• Prepare weekly artist fees schedule for payment

• Administer ADP’s electronic time & attendance system including new employee setup and training

• Import and review payable hours from time & attendance system

• Support Payroll Manager with other payroll processing tasks as needed

• Provide vacation cover and backup for Payroll Manager

Employee Data Maintenance:

• Setup new hires in ADP Workforce Now

• Maintain accuracy of employee information in payroll system including payroll deductions, salary/title changes and benefits status/eligibility changes

• Administer Paid Time Off accruals for non-union employees

• Perform terminations in payroll and time & attendance systems

• Create and run payroll reports from ADP Workforce Now as requested

Human Resources:

• Process responses to unemployment notices

• Coordinate workers compensation insurance compliance including incident log maintenance and claim initiation

• Support HR Department as needed



A Bachelor’s degree is preferred as well as 2-4 years of experience working in a finance office environment.



The ideal candidate will have experience working in the performing arts and will bring a fundamental understanding and experience with theatrical unions and non-union payroll and accounts payable, preferably for a not-for-profit organization. S/he will possess excellent analytical skills and be highly organized and self-motivated. Attention to detail and ability to take initiative is a must.

• Strong computer skills and knowledge of Excel and Word are required

• Experience working with HRIS and payroll systems required

• Knowledge of ADP Workforce Now preferred

Mission: Roundabout Theatre Company is committed to producing the highest quality theatre with the finest artists, sharing stories that endure, and providing accessibility to all audiences. A not-for-profit company, Roundabout fulfills its mission each season through the production of classic plays and musicals; development and production of new works by established and emerging writers; educational initiatives that enrich the lives of children and adults; and a subscription model and audience outreach programs that cultivate and engage all audiences. www.roundabouttheatre.org
